Tobias Picker

Dolores Claiborne (chamber version)

Text informationlibretto by J. D. McClatchy based on the book by Stephen King
Year(s) composed2013/2017
PublisherSchott Music
Instrumentationopera in two acts
Duration120'
PremiereOctober 22, 2017 New York, NY, 59E59 Theater (USA) · Conductor: Pacien Mazzagatti · New York City Opera Orchestra · Staging: Michael Capasso
CommissionThe original version of Dolores Claiborne was commissioned by the San Francisco Opera and was premiered on September 8, 2013 at the War Memorial Opera House in San Francisco, California. The 2017 New York chamber version of Dolores Claiborne was made possible in part by generous support from New York City Opera and Boston University Opera Institute.
LanguageEnglish
RolesVera Donovan · soprano - Selena · soprano - Dolores Claiborne · mezzo-soprano - Detective Thibodeau · tenor - Joe St. George · bass-baritone
Composer note

Dolores Claiborne is a character destined for the operatic stage – passionate, desperate, trapped. She will do anything to save the daughter who despises her. Pushed to the extreme edge of life, she does what she has to, fearless and forsaken.

I have wanted to write this opera for years. Yes, Stephen King is a master of suspense, but he is also a remarkable reader of human desires and fears. The superb team that San Francisco Opera has assembled allowed me to compose a powerful, heart-stopping piece of music theater for a cast of brilliant voices. Tobias Picker
